In 'But Not the Hippopotamus', the story revolves around a quirky group of animals who are all invited to join in various fun activities, but the hippopotamus is conspicuously left out—until the end. The participating animals include a dog, a cat, a rabbit, a turtle, a bird, and a moose, each engaging in playful antics like jumping, running, or dancing. The dog might be seen wagging its tail excitedly, while the cat elegantly prances around. The rabbit hops with boundless energy, and the turtle, though slow, adds its own charm. Even the bird flutters in delight, and the moose—yes, a moose—lumbers along with unexpected grace. The hippopotamus, initially hesitant and left watching from the sidelines, finally joins the fun, making the story a heartwarming lesson about inclusion. The book’s genius lies in its simplicity and rhythm, using repetitive phrasing to draw kids into the narrative. Each animal’s unique way of moving adds layers of humor and relatability. The hippopotamus’s eventual participation feels like a quiet triumph, subtly teaching children about belonging without heavy-handedness. Sandra Boynton’s illustrations amplify the fun, with exaggerated expressions that make every creature unforgettable.

Brook B from 'One Piece' is a character that blends comedy and depth in such a unique way. He’s a skeleton who plays music, which already sounds outlandish, right? But let’s dive deeper! Born over 90 years ago, he has lived his life beyond death, all thanks to the power of the Yomi Yomi no Mi fruit. This fruit gave him the chance to return to life after dying, but in a very unexpected way – as a skeleton! What’s super fascinating is his backstory with the Rumbar Pirates. They were on a mission to fulfill a promise to their dying captain to get back to his home island, but tragedy struck. Brook was the sole survivor, which has shaped him into this optimistic figure despite the darkness he’s faced. His loyalty to his lost friends is both heartwarming and heartbreaking. Then there’s his love for music! Every time he pulls out his violin, it’s like he’s almost transcending his skeletal form, connecting everyone with joy. It’s a wild and emotional ride when you think about his character arcs throughout the series. Plus, there’s the whole “Yohohoho” laugh! It’s so distinct and endearing, echoing his cheerful personality despite being a walking skeleton. Every performance he gives in the show is not just a musical event; it’s a celebration of life, death, and the moments in between. Seriously, if you dive into his character development, you realize just how rich and layered he is amidst all the madness that 'One Piece' offers!

I stumbled upon 'Momosas: Fun Alcohol-Free Drinks for Expecting Moms' while browsing for creative mocktail recipes, and it quickly became a favorite! The author, Natalie Bovis, is a mixologist with a knack for crafting vibrant, flavorful drinks that don’t rely on alcohol. Her background in the beverage industry shines through—she’s also written other books like 'The Liquid Muse' and 'Mocktails,' so she knows her stuff. What I love about this book is how it transforms the idea of 'missing out' during pregnancy into a celebration of creativity. The recipes are playful, elegant, and perfect for baby showers or just treating yourself. Natalie’s approach feels so inclusive, too. She doesn’t just cater to expecting moms; anyone looking for tasty alcohol-free options can enjoy these. The book’s tone is warm and encouraging, almost like a friend sharing secret recipes. It’s rare to find a niche topic handled with this much flair, but she pulls it off. I’ve tried her 'Virgin Bellini' and 'Cucumber Cooler,' and they’ve become staples at my gatherings. Definitely a gem for anyone exploring the world of mocktails!
